WebRule Summary View Official Rule. ILLEGAL MOTION. When the ball is snapped, one player who is lined up in the backfield may be in motion, provided that he is moving parallel to or away from the line of scrimmage. No player is permitted to be moving toward the line of scrimmage when the ball is snapped. All other players must be stationary in ...

In gridiron football, an ineligible receiver downfield, or an ineligible man downfield, is a penalty called against the offensive team when a forward pass is thrown while a player who is ineligible to receive a pass is beyond the line of scrimmage without blocking an opponent at the time of the pass. WebA route is a pattern or path that a receiver in gridiron football runs to get open for a forward pass. WebJun 1, 2024 · The X receiver is also known as a split end or a “wideout.”. This player is often the offense’s most talented receiver. Common routes this wide receiver will run are fly routes, dig routes, and slant routes. …

A screen pass is a play where the quarterback fakes a handoff or long pass but instead throws a short pass to a receiver who has positioned himself behind a group of blockers. Illegal forward pass. A player throws the ball forward once they are past the line of scrimmage. -5 yards from line of scrimmage and loss of down.
